Abstract
The mechanism comprises a cylinder block (10) with radial pistons, the block rotating in a fixed casing (1A, 1B), a distribution cover (1A) forming part of the casing and having admission and exhaust pipes (3A, 3B) extending between an outer face (1'A) and an inner face (1'A) of the cover. The internal distributor (22) has distribution pipes (24A, 24B) selectively connected to the admission and exhaust pipes, opening onto a distribution face (22B) which is perpendicular to the axis of rotation and which is arranged against the communication face (10A) of the cylinder block allowing the distribution pipes to communicate with the pipes of cylinders (18). On a transverse face (11) of the cylinder block (10) there is, in an area (Z) bounded radially on the outside by bottom parts (12A) of the cylinders (12), an axial depression (30) containing at least part of the distributor (22) containing the distribution face (22B), and the communication face (10A) is formed in a planar surface of this depression (30).
